How does it happen? This disease is inherited by a recessive gene on the x chromosome.Males are mostly effected and the females are mainly carriers.this diseases is an x linked disorder. Females have two x chromos-omes and males have an x and a y chromosomes. When the x chrom-osome gets attached to the female chromosomes the other x chromosomecan fight off the disorder. When it gets attached to the male chromosome the y chromosome cant fight it off and it gets carried into the offspring. This is a disease that effects the development of skin,hair,teeth,nails, and sweat glands.The skin is usuallythin and dry. If this disease is not diagnosed at an early age, it cam lead to brain damage then eventuallydeath. Heat can worsen this disorder so it is managed its not too much.. Even though it is most common in males,females can get it too Anyone from any racecan inherit this disorder Is there a cure? There is no known cure but there are treatmentsto ease the symptoms. For babies, there is acontinuous monitoring on heat in an incubator. For older people, the have special cooling clothes.People with this disorder have to rink large amounts of cool drinks so not only the outside but the insideof their body stays cool. As for the teeth issue, ata young age orthadontic appointments are made soteeth can be fixed to look normal. This disorder is rarearound the world.1 in 17,000 peopleare effected.
